3.99 is only used for the gtk3 version which will enter version 4.0
when released.

The reason that fancy was not included is caused by missing
dependencies. This is missing on your debian: libwebkit2gtk-4.0-dev

Install it at do the following in your source folder:
./config.status --recheck
make && sudo make install
